智能语音助手如何理解复杂的指令?
在科技飞速发展的今天,智能语音助手已经成为了我们日常生活中不可或缺的一部分。从简单的语音唤醒,到复杂的任务执行,智能语音助手已经能够理解并执行各种指令。那么,智能语音助手是如何理解复杂的指令的呢?本文将通过一个故事,带您走进智能语音助手的内部世界。
故事的主人公名叫小明,是一名年轻的科技公司职员。他每天的工作都很忙碌,经常需要处理各种复杂的事务。为了提高工作效率,小明购买了一台搭载智能语音助手的智能音箱。这台音箱能够理解他的语音指令,并为他执行各种任务,让小明的生活变得更加便捷。
有一天,小明突然接到一个紧急的电话,需要立即处理一项重要的工作任务。然而,当时他正在会议室参加会议,无法离开座位。他灵机一动,对智能音箱说:“小爱同学,帮我打开会议室的投影仪,播放一下那份工作报告。”
智能音箱立即响起了“好的,正在为您执行任务”的声音。小明心想,这不过是件小事,智能音箱应该能轻松应对。然而,他并不知道,这个看似简单的指令背后,隐藏着智能语音助手复杂的理解过程。
首先,智能语音助手需要将小明的语音指令转化为文本。这需要借助语音识别技术,将声波信号转化为数字信号,并对其进行解码,得到文本信息。在这一过程中,智能语音助手需要处理多种语音变体、方言、口音等问题,确保指令的准确性。
接着,智能语音助手需要理解文本信息中的语义。这需要借助自然语言处理技术,对文本信息进行分词、词性标注、句法分析等操作,提取出关键信息。例如,小明提到的“会议室的投影仪”,智能语音助手需要识别出“会议室”、“投影仪”这两个实体,并理解它们之间的关系。
然后,智能语音助手需要根据理解到的语义,调用相应的功能模块。在这个例子中,智能语音助手需要调用“控制投影仪”的功能模块。然而,控制投影仪并非一件简单的事情,它需要智能语音助手与投影仪设备之间的通信。
为了实现这一通信,智能语音助手需要利用智能家居控制技术,将指令发送到投影仪设备。这需要智能语音助手具备网络通信能力,能够解析设备协议,发送控制指令。
在发送指令后,智能语音助手还需要等待投影仪设备的反馈。如果投影仪设备成功接收到指令并执行,智能语音助手会向小明发送确认信息;如果投影仪设备出现故障或无法执行指令,智能语音助手会反馈错误信息,并提出解决方案。
回到小明的例子,当智能语音助手完成以上步骤后,会议室的投影仪成功打开,工作报告也顺利播放。小明松了一口气,感慨道:“智能语音助手真厉害,竟然能理解这么复杂的指令。”
事实上,智能语音助手理解复杂的指令并非易事。随着人工智能技术的不断发展,智能语音助手在语音识别、自然语言处理、智能家居控制等方面取得了显著成果。然而,仍有许多挑战等待着它们去克服。
例如,在多轮对话场景中,智能语音助手需要具备更强的上下文理解能力,以应对用户提出的各种问题。此外,智能语音助手还需不断提高自己的学习能力,以适应不断变化的用户需求。
总之,智能语音助手理解复杂的指令是一个复杂的过程,涉及到多个领域的知识和技术。随着人工智能技术的不断进步,我们有理由相信,智能语音助手将越来越智能,为我们的生活带来更多便利。而小明的故事,也只是一个缩影,展示了智能语音助手在生活中的广泛应用。
猜你喜欢:AI实时语音